Description
Summary:This study was conducted in Biology Dept., College of Science for women , Baghdad University in year 2010 to identify the effect of Biofungus Metarihizum anisopliae in some different stages of saw toothed grain beetle Oryzaephilitis suriuamensis . The eggs in age of 24 and 72 hours, Larvae in second fourth instar and pupae in age 24 and 72 were treated with fungal dilution 4.8×10 -6 , 4.8×10 -4 and 4.8×10 -2 . Results of the study showed the following : Non – hatching eggs at the age at 24 hours with fungal suspension 4.8 x 10-2, while 100% the highest mortality rate for egg , but lowest rate mortality was 23.3% of dilution 4.8 x 10-4. The highest mortality of four larvae stage 66.6% indilution 4.8 x 10-4. The highest mortality of pupa 73.3% in 72 hours.
